How to Wrap Lil Smokies in a Blanket

When I first tried making these, I made a rookie mistake by cutting the dough too short. But no worries! I’ve figured out the perfect method to ensure each piece is cut just right every time. Here’s how to do it:

  • Measure It Out: Place the sausage at the edge of the dough to get the right length.
  • Cut the Strip: Slice the dough into a strip that’s roughly the length of the sausage.
  • Roll It Up: Place the sausage on the edge of the dough and roll it until it overlaps slightly.
  • Trim Excess: Cut the dough where it overlaps just a bit.
  • Seal It: Pinch the edges together to keep that smoky goodness tucked inside.
  • Repeat: Place on a cookie sheet and keep rolling until you’re done!

How to Bake Your Lil Smokies in a Blanket

Here’s the deal: homemade puff pastry dough won’t brown up quite like Pillsbury. If you prefer a softer dough, brush each wrapped sausage with an egg wash before baking. Pro tip: for an extra crispy finish, pop them in the air fryer for 5 minutes after baking!

Little Smokies In A Blanket

Pigs in a Blanket are a crowd pleaser as an appetizer. The puff pastry dough bakes up flaky and buttery, enveloping the miniature hot dog pieces perfectly.
5 from 1 vote
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Course Appetizer
Cuisine American
Servings 8 servings
Calories 197 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 1 recipe for flaky puff pastry dough (See above for links)
  • 20 Lil Smokies (dried off on a paper towel)
  • 1 cup cheddar cheese (shredded)
  • egg wash (optional)

Instructions
 

  • Make the puff pastry dough and let rest in fridge for 1-2 hours.
  • Preheat oven to 350℉ and line a cookie sheet with parchment paper for easy clean up. Set the puff pastry dough out for 5-10 minutes so the dough softens slightly (this will ensure it doesn't break when you unroll it).
  • Cut puff pastry dough into 1 inch by 2 inch sections. Sprinkle a small amount of cheddar cheese on the dough. Top with a Lil Smokies hotdog and roll the pastry up around it, pinching the end to the dough to secure. Place on a the cookie sheet and repeat with the remaining lil smokes.
    How to Roll a Little Smoky into a Crescent Roll Dough
  • Optional Step that will result in a more golden brown surface: Brush the tops with egg wash.
  • Bake 12-15 minutes or until the dough is cooked through. Serve immediately.
